Web21 nov. 2024 · What does iodine do to plastic bags? This can be demonstrated using iodine and starch. Iodine easily diffuses through the plastic bag. Starch is too big to diffuse through the plastic bag. When iodine reacts with starch, it turns blue. What color changes did you observe in the bag and in the iodine solution?

First, we sealed one end of a moist dialysis tube by tying it into a knot. We then filled this tube with a starch solution and sealed the other end the same way. Next, we placed the dialysis tube into a beaker filled with distilled water.
